In the realm of welding automation and manual fabrication, the reliability of control electronics is paramount. The circuit card acts as the central processing unit for operator inputs, translating the physical pull of a trigger into a coordinated sequence of electrical outputs. This includes engaging the main contactor, opening gas solenoid valves, and initiating the wire drive motor. A malfunction in this specific board can lead to erratic arc initiation, failure to latch, or a complete loss of trigger response, bringing production to a halt.
